Description
The 1866 model or Yellowboy, as it was famously known because of its shiny brass frame, was the successor to the Henry rifle. It features a brass frame, brass forend cap & butt plate, blued & case hardened steel parts, octagonal barrel, dovetail buckhorn rear and front blade sight, and a walnut rifle style butt stock.
